Building an Outdoor Kitchen: Layout, Materials & Costs
By Hovenier Hoofddorp · Updated July 31, 2026
An outdoor kitchen ranges from a simple built-in BBQ module against the wall to a complete cooking island with a sink, fridge and worktop next to the pool. Price follows that scale: budget €1,500 to €5,000 for a simple module and €8,000 to €20,000+ for a complete outdoor kitchen with utility connections. As with a patio, the sub-base and the gas, water and electrical connections determine most of the outcome.

What belongs in a complete outdoor kitchen?
- Cooking element: a built-in gas or charcoal barbecue, sometimes with a pizza oven or side burner.
- Worktop: stainless steel, concrete or a weather-resistant natural stone/ceramic slab as prep space next to the grill.
- Sink and fridge: for a true outdoor kitchen that avoids constant trips back inside — needs a water and electrical connection.
- Storage: weatherproof cabinets for gas bottles, tools and tableware.
- A covered structure: protection from rain and harsh sun considerably extends the usable season — see our covered structure and poolhouse guide.
Which material suits an outdoor kitchen?
| Material (housing/worktop) | Characteristics |
|---|---|
| Stainless steel | Hygienic, heat-resistant, industrial look; can show scratches. |
| Concrete (polished or rendered) | Robust, shapeable, suits a modern villa garden well; porous unless sealed. |
| Natural stone / ceramic worktop | Premium look, heat-resistant, stain-resistant with ceramic; higher cost. |
| Hardwood (cabinet fronts) | Warm look for doors and framing; needs periodic maintenance. |
For a villa garden we prefer materials that match the patio and poolhouse, so the outdoor kitchen reads as part of one design rather than a separate add-on.
What does an outdoor kitchen cost in 2026?
| Type | Guide price 2026 |
|---|---|
| Simple built-in BBQ module (no utility connections) | €1,500 – €5,000 |
| Complete outdoor kitchen with cooking island and worktop | €8,000 – €20,000 |
| Premium outdoor kitchen with cover, heating and full connections | €20,000 – €50,000+ |
Water, gas and electrical connections are the biggest unplanned cost if not accounted for upfront. On a new garden build or villa garden project, we run conduits as standard, even if the outdoor kitchen is only added in a later phase.
Where should you position the outdoor kitchen?
- Wind direction: position the cooking zone so smoke from the grill does not blow straight towards the terrace or living room by default.
- Near the patio: an outdoor kitchen within walking distance of the dining table gets used far more than one tucked away at the back of the garden.
- Permits: an open, uncovered outdoor kitchen is generally permit-free; once you add a fixed roof or enclosed walls, the same rules apply as for a covered structure or poolhouse. We check this for your address in advance.

Do I need a permit for an outdoor kitchen?
An open outdoor kitchen without a fixed roof or walls is generally permit-free, the same as a freestanding barbecue. Once you add a covered structure or enclosed construction, the outbuilding permit rules apply — similar to a poolhouse or garden house. We check this in advance for your specific situation.
Can an outdoor kitchen be used year-round?
With a covered structure and optional outdoor heating, an outdoor kitchen remains highly usable outside summer too. Without cover, it is mainly a seasonal feature from April to October. The utility connections (gas, water, electrics) keep working year-round provided they are laid frost-free.
